The effectiveness of a pre-made filling for closing an open-apex tooth root

Evaluating the efficacy of prefabricated bio-root inlay in apexification success in necrotic immature permanent teeth: a randomized control trial

Conditions

Necrotic immature permanent upper incisors in children Oral Health

Interventions

Thirty necrotic maxillary immature incisors from healthy children aged between 7-11 years will be randomly divided into two groups using http://www.randomization.com: Group A (control)

Inclusion criteria

Inclusion criteria: Patients with one or more maxillary incisors with an open apex root (defined as root with root canal size equal to or larger than #80 K-file) and presented with pulp necrosis and radiographic evidence of chronic apical periodontitis and periapical radiolucency greater than 3 mm

Exclusion criteria

Exclusion criteria: 1. Children with systemic diseases that compromised their general immune status 2. Uncooperative (definitely negative on the Frankl's behavioral scale) 3. Unrestorable incisors

Design outcomes

Primary

MeasureTime frame
1. Clinical evaluation: Patients of both groups will be recalled after 1, 3, 7, and 14 days of treatment and during radiographical assessment periods (3, 6 and 12 months), where they will be asked to rate their pain on the Wong-Baker Faces Scale, where children will set their pain levels by choosing a face; 0 = no hurt, 1 = hurts a little bit, 2 = hurts a little more 3 = hurts even more, 4 = hurts a whole lot, and 5 = hurts worst. Moreover, the presence of fistula, swelling, and movement will be recorded. 2. Radiographical assessment: After coronal restoration is completed a control x-ray will be taken. The periapical status will be assessed at the time of obturation-restoration, 3, 6, and 12 months following endodontic treatment. The outcome will be determined according to the Periapical Index scoring system: (1) normal periapical structures; (2) small changes in bone structure; (3) changes in bone structure with some mineral loss; (4) periodontitis with well-defined radiolucent area; (5) severe periodontitis with exacerbating features. The teeth will be evaluated according to healed, healing or unsuccessful as a primary radiographical outcome.

Secondary

MeasureTime frame
1. Patient age (in years) and sex (male or female) determined during patient examination at the start of treatment 2. Required time for obturation of each case (in minutes) measured using a timer during the obturation phase 3. Child behavior (definitely positive, positive, and negative) will be determined by an external examiner during overall treatment visits 4. Extrusion of bioceramics (extrusion, or not extrusion) measured using a digital X-ray image at the end of the obturation phase 5. Apex diameter (in mm) and working length (in mm) measured using large sized K-file at the preparation phase
